/* <UTF8> char here is either ASCII or handled as a whole */
#ifdef HAVE_CONFIG_H
#include <config.h>
#endif
#include <Defn.h>
#include <Rconnections.h>
#include <Rdynpriv.h>
#include <R_ext/R-ftp-http.h>
#include <Rmodules/Rinternet.h>
static R_InternetRoutines routines, *ptr = &routines;
/*
SEXP attribute_hidden do_download(SEXP call, SEXP op, SEXP args, SEXP env);
Rconnection R_newurl(char *description, char *mode);
Rconnection R_newsock(char *host, int port, int server, char *mode);
Next 6 are for use by libxml, only
void *R_HTTPOpen(const char *url);
int R_HTTPRead(void *ctx, char *dest, int len);
void R_HTTPClose(void *ctx);
void *R_FTPOpen(const char *url);
int R_FTPRead(void *ctx, char *dest, int len);
void R_FTPClose(void *ctx);
void Rsockopen(int *port)
void Rsocklisten(int *sockp, char **buf, int *len)
void Rsockconnect(int *port, char **host)
void Rsockclose(int *sockp)
void Rsockread(int *sockp, char **buf, int *maxlen)
void Rsockwrite(int *sockp, char **buf, int *start, int *end, int *len)
int Rsockselect(int nsock, int *insockfd, int *ready, int *write,
double timeout)
*/
static int initialized = 0;
R_InternetRoutines *
R_setInternetRoutines(R_InternetRoutines *routines)
{
R_InternetRoutines *tmp;
tmp = ptr;
ptr = routines;
return(tmp);
}
#ifdef Win32
extern Rboolean UseInternet2;
#endif
static void internet_Init(void)
{
int res;
#ifdef Win32
res = UseInternet2 ? R_moduleCdynload("internet2", 1, 1) :
R_moduleCdynload("internet", 1, 1);
#else
res = R_moduleCdynload("internet", 1, 1);
#endif
initialized = -1;
if(!res) return;
if(!ptr->download)
error(_("internet routines cannot be accessed in module"));
initialized = 1;
return;
}
SEXP attribute_hidden do_download(SEXP call, SEXP op, SEXP args, SEXP env)
{
if(!initialized) internet_Init();
if(initialized > 0)
return (*ptr->download)(call, op, args, env);
else {
error(_("internet routines cannot be loaded"));
return R_NilValue;
}
}
